Transaction 7d1123814ce8a56722876672e49d283a1e8667e1ab9f819ad00267bccb077f60

2 Input
2 Outputs
  • 7d1123814ce8a56722876672e49d283a1e8667e1ab9f819ad00267bccb077f60:0
  • value  434440
    address  3M3oxpesLEHdp8SDMzj5JS7jCfq21YBtLw
  • 7d1123814ce8a56722876672e49d283a1e8667e1ab9f819ad00267bccb077f60:1
  • value  876460
    address  3C6eYqdEoSmtnN2PXUmeujfMnHA6539cTy